A touch of Sweden comes to Shropshire

 
Organisers have arranged for a "Barbecue Zone" at the SinS Campsite which they are hoping will be a real social highlight of the event.

As with many things - it started as a necessity - the caterers have withdrawn because not enough people have pre-booked meals. Also - we are not allowed to have barbecues on the grass as too many people have put their disposables on the ground and burnt holes in the pitches - so - how could we turn this to our advantage and make sure you campers get something to eat?

Well! Thinking back to last year's Swedish O-ringen - when due to fire risk the organisers set up Barbecue Zones - These turned out to be a great social focus point - the Brit colonised one and had a good time.

So, the idea is to set up a cordoned off "Barbecue Zone" where you can either bring your own BBQs or use the communal ones - come as a club, group of friends or individuals. There will also be an outdoor seating area to develop a sort of Bistro atmosphere where you can sit and chat with friends over your maps and a glass of wine - sounds good doesn't it?

You'll have a good view of the early evening "O" Lympic Biathalon (Saturday 3-legged 20 minute score race - Sunday The Run-In competition). and you'll be nice and close for one of Liz Furness' excellent Quiz Evenings on Saturday and Sunday's barn-storming Ceilidh.
 
The Barbecue zone will be open each evening from 5pm where you can bring your own barbecues or use one of the big communal ones to cook your own food - why not link up with club mates to make a party. A seating area will be provided - but feel free to add your own tables and chairs to it. In the event of bad weather food may be eaten in the school refectory. NB - Please do not bring liquid fire lighting fuel - solid lighters or self-lighting charcoal only.
